A bowl of floating hellebore blooms, fresh from the late-winter garden . . . the first jonquils of spring, fragrant and bright in a bud vase . . . a magnificent bouquet of summer roses, redolent of grandmother's garden . . . a centerpiece of asters, mums, and Shasta daisies for the first tailgate of autumn. These are the pleasures of growing cut flowers in your garden.
